Skip to Main Content

Concentra Urgent Care - Midtown

Categories Health & Well-Being Urgent Care

Address

688 Spring St NW View on Google Maps
Atlanta, GA 30308
404-881-1155

visit website

Nearby MARTA Rail Stations

Nearby Arts & Attractions

Nearby Shop & Dine